The world is in a recession comparable to the Great Depression of the 1930s. If you are now living on a smaller income and hope to supplement your income with some extra cash, here are several ways to do so. Most of these methods are through the Internet (probably the most useful invention of our day).
1. Of course, one of the ways to earn extra cash is through this website,
www.helium.com. If you are not a writer with this website, come here and explore. In a nutshell, in this website, you just have to write articles and rate other articles and you can earn extra cash easily. An article can earn you between 50 US cents and US$2.50 upfront.
2. Another website that pays you to write is www.associatedcontent.com. This website offers Upfront Payments ranging from US$1 to US$20 for certain types of content, but this is only payable to US citizens or legal residents of the United States. All of the content you publish can earn you money via Performance Payments, which currently pays a baseline rate of US$1.50 for every one thousand views your article receives. I find that pay-you-to-write websites are quite good as I find that writing an article doesn't take you more than half an hour. Getting an extra dollar an hour may seem like a pittance, but it does help to contribute to your family finances. Every cent counts in this time and day.
3. Another website that I have used is www.beatthat.com. This website pays you to find deals on the Internet for electronic products, such as TVs and cameras. I used to use it as my main source of online income but it has gotten harder and harder to find deals, so I have stopped using it. Finding ("beating") a deal earns you between 50 US cents and US$2, depending on the reliability and quality of the dealer, which is rated by BeatThat! members.
4. Another website I have used before is www.mylot.com. MyLot is an online discussion website, which pays you for starting discussions and replying to discussions. MyLot pays you about 1 US cent (this is an estimate by users) per reply to any discussion of your choice, but payment rates are less clear for posting discussions. MyLot also pays you for referring people. You get 25% of your referrals' earnings. The minimum payout is US$10 via PayPal. I consider MyLot a slow way to make money, and that is why I have also stopped using it.
5. A website that I am using now is www.emailcashpro.com. This is a Singaporean pay-to-read-email company, and therefore it pays in Singapore dollars (this may make it less attractive to foreigners). It pays about S$0.005 to S$0.01 per e-mail you read. So far, I have earned an average of S$0.20 a month. The minimum payout is S$10 via PayPal. To me, Emailcashpro is leisure income, so I have not stopped using it.
These are 5 websites from which you can earn money from. The money earned may seem insignificant, but in this time and day, I think every cent counts. I hope you have gained something from this article.
